About this property
Experience luxurious living in this brand-new townhome located within the prestigious community of Newman Village, served by the highly acclaimed Frisco Independent School District. Positioned on a desirable corner lot adjacent to the community courtyard, this townhome offers an exceptional blend of privacy and prime location. Upon execution of a one-year lease, the landlord will provide a brand-new refrigerator, washer, and dryer for your convenience. Designed with a modern open-concept layout, the main living area seamlessly integrates the family room, dining space, and gourmet kitchen—all enhanced by elegant LVP flooring and abundant natural light streaming through expansive windows and soaring ceilings. The spacious first-floor primary suite features a spa-inspired en-suite bath, an oversized frameless glass shower, and a generously sized walk-in closet. Ascend the sleek, modern staircase to the second level, where you’ll find a large loft-style living area with a tray ceiling, a private office nook, and two additional well-appointed bedrooms with a jack and jill bath.

Learn About the Market: Opportunity in Texas




Explore
Texas
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
